The Anatomy of Ingredients: Choosing the Best for Your Salad
To achieve the forensic visual accuracy required for this dish, every ingredient must serve a specific culinary purpose. Do not substitute high-quality rice vinegar for regular white vinegar, as the acidity profile is drastically different.
1. Japanese or Persian Cucumbers: You need small, thin-skinned cucumbers with minimal seeds. These allow for those visible corrugated ridges and the translucent emerald green appearance. You will need approximately 1 lb (450g) of cucumbers.
2. Seasoned Rice Vinegar: This forms the base of our clear rice vinegar dressing glaze. It provides the essential tang without overpowering the delicate vegetable flavor. You’ll use 1/4 cup (60ml).
3. Toasted Sesame Seeds: A mixture of toasted white sesame seeds and toasted black sesame seeds is non-negotiable. They provide the “heavily garnished” look and a nutty aromatic finish. Use 1 tbsp (15g) of each.
4. Fresh Red Chili: Use one small Fresno or bird’s eye chili. The tiny, vibrant red chili rings provide a controlled heat and a necessary pop of color against the green cucumbers. Adjust to your heat preference, similar to a spicy sushi cucumber salad.
5. Coarse Sea Salt Flakes: Used both for drawing out moisture and as a finishing garnish. The flakes of coarse sea salt visible on the edges provide a sudden burst of salinity that awakens the palate.

Step-by-Step Instructions for the Perfect Sushi Cucumber Salad
1. Achieving the Paper-Thin Translucent Slice
Start by washing your cucumbers thoroughly. To get the paper-thin, translucent emerald green discs, use a mandoline slicer set to the narrowest setting (approximately 1mm). If you look closely at the edges, you should see visible corrugated ridges. Slice 1 lb (450g) of cucumbers steadily. The slices should be so thin that you can almost see through them when held up to natural light.
2. The Osmosis Process (The Secret to Crunch)
Place the sliced cucumbers in a colander and sprinkle with 1 tsp (5g) of coarse sea salt. Toss gently and let sit for 10 minutes. This process, known as osmosis, draws out excess water, ensuring your Sushi Cucumber Salad doesn’t become soggy. After 10 minutes, gently squeeze the cucumbers with a clean kitchen towel to remove the liquid. They should now feel flexible yet crisp.
3. Crafting the Clear Rice Vinegar Dressing Glaze
In a small glass bowl, whisk together 1/4 cup (60ml) of seasoned rice vinegar, 1 tsp (5g) of sugar (optional, to balance), and 1/2 tsp (2.5ml) of soy sauce for depth. The goal is a clear rice vinegar glaze that catches the light without darkening the bright green of the cucumbers. Unlike a cucumber vinegar salad, this version focuses on a light, shimmering coat rather than a heavy soak.
4. The Assembly and Garnish
Transfer the prepared cucumbers to a matte black ceramic bowl. Drizzle the clear rice vinegar dressing glaze over the top and toss lightly. Now, for the visual drama: heavily garnish the salad with 1 tbsp (15g) each of toasted white sesame seeds and toasted black sesame seeds. Add the tiny, vibrant red chili rings, distributing them evenly for a professional look. Finish with a final pinch of coarse sea salt flakes on the edges.
Expert Tips for Culinary Success
- Chill Your Bowl: For the most refreshing experience, place your matte black ceramic bowl in the freezer for 5 minutes before serving to keep the Sushi Cucumber Salad ice-cold.
- Seed Toasting: If your sesame seeds aren’t pre-toasted, toss them in a dry skillet over medium heat for 2 minutes until fragrant. This step is vital for the authentic food blog aesthetic and flavor.
- Knife Skills: If you don’t have a mandoline, use a very sharp chef’s knife and aim for consistent 1mm thickness. Consistency is key for even marination.
- Control the Heat: If you prefer a milder version, remove the seeds from the fresh red chili rings before slicing. For more heat, look into our spicy cucumber salad variations.
Storage and Preparation Ahead of Time
This Sushi Cucumber Salad is best enjoyed within 30 minutes of assembly to maintain the crisp, wet texture of the vegetables. However, you can prep the components in advance. Store the salted, squeezed cucumbers in an airtight container for up to 4 hours. Keep the clear rice vinegar glaze in a separate jar. Combine and garnish just before serving to prevent the emerald green discs from losing their structural integrity.
Do not freeze this salad. The high water content of the cucumbers will cause them to turn mushy upon thawing, destroying the delicate translucent appearance we worked so hard to achieve.
